Initial commit: dial — interactive SSH host picker
A fast, read-only ~/.ssh/config picker that exec's the system ssh client. Includes: static high-contrast picker with recency/frequency/name sort and tag grouping, `dial keygen` (native ed25519/RSA + optional config entry), and an optional offline YubiKey launch gate with one-time recovery codes.
